数据库全攻略:速搭稳护,高效运维指南
|
数据库是现代应用系统的核心,承载着数据存储、查询和事务处理等关键功能。无论是小型项目还是大型企业级应用,合理的数据库设计和高效运维都是保障系统稳定运行的基础。 在搭建数据库时,应根据业务需求选择合适的类型,如关系型数据库(MySQL、PostgreSQL)或非关系型数据库(MongoDB、Redis)。每种数据库都有其适用场景,合理选型能提升性能并降低维护成本。 为了确保数据库的稳定性,需要建立完善的备份与恢复机制。定期备份数据,并测试恢复流程,可以有效应对数据丢失或损坏的风险。同时,监控系统性能指标,如CPU使用率、磁盘空间和连接数,有助于提前发现潜在问题。 优化查询语句和索引设计是提升数据库效率的关键。避免全表扫描,合理使用索引,减少不必要的JOIN操作,能够显著提高响应速度。定期清理无用数据和优化表结构,也能保持数据库的高效运转。 安全防护同样不可忽视。设置强密码策略、限制访问权限、启用SSL加密传输,都是防止数据泄露的重要措施。同时,及时更新数据库版本,修复已知漏洞,可以增强系统的安全性。 良好的运维习惯能帮助团队更高效地管理数据库。制定标准化的操作流程,记录每次变更和故障处理过程,便于后续排查和改进。借助自动化工具进行日常维护,也能节省大量时间和人力成本。
AI设计,仅供参考 通过科学的设计、持续的优化和严谨的运维,数据库才能真正成为支撑业务发展的坚实后盾。掌握这些核心要点,不仅能提升系统稳定性,还能为未来扩展打下良好基础。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

